** DAY 40 -- Change of Stewardship

Only forty days until we start being missionaries.  The count down is going slowly, but it is going rapidly.  It is going slowly as I consider we have that long to wait until we can serve full time.  It is going rapidly since there are so many things to do that I wonder if we will get them all done before forty days have expired.

When I get boggled down with "things" and "stuff" I pause and think of that glorious different existence we will enjoy in more than 40 days.  That will be a time when we won't have to worry about bills, getting things done, making sure that we are available for kids and grand kids and church assignments, family and other.  It will be a time when the "stuff" of this life will be put on the back burner and we will be privileged to have our main, our only goal is furthering the Kingdom.

Yes I know, we are still parents and grand parents.  Yes we will still be interested in the happenings that happen in our family, extended family, and even dearly beloved associates, but our main focus will change from what it is today to what our Father and His Son desire of us.  We will be concerned about our stewardship.

I guess that is the main difference.  Our stewardship will change.  That is what I have desired since that day over forty years ago when I climbed off that plane in Texas, wishing I could return to be full time doing Father's work.  It will be glorious.

Miracles continue to happen.  Father is a Father of miracles and His work will go on, whether we notice His miracles or not.  I am grateful for that, for often He blesses with miracles that we didn't even know we desired.  I offer gratitude to Him for His tender mercies, His ever watchful care, and His taking care of us, whether  we agree with His timing, His methods, or His miracles.
